#1f01be hex color
In a RGB color space, hex #1f01be is composed of 12.2% red, 0.4% green and 74.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 83.7% cyan, 99.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 25.5% black. It has a hue angle of 249.5 degrees, a saturation of 99% and a lightness of 37.5%. #1f01be color hex could be obtained by blending #3e02ff with #00007d. Closest websafe color is: #3300cc.

● #1f01be color description : Strong blue.
The hexadecimal color #1f01be has RGB values of R:31, G:1, B:190 and CMYK values of C:0.84, M:0.99, Y:0, K:0.25. Its decimal value is 2032062.
